The U.S.S. Enterprise was a Constitution-class Cruiser launched in 2258 of the Kelvin Timeline, an alternate reality created by the actions of Nero and Spock.
History[ | ]
The Enterprise was launched in 2258 under Captain Pike. Command rapidly passed to Kirk before the ship was destroyed in 2263.

Missions involved[ | ]
- “The Measure of Morality (Part 2)”: A simulacrum of the Kelvin Timeline Enterprise, along with several other starships from the Prime Timeline, battles against a renegade Excalbian simulacrum Borg Queen.
Missions mentioned[ | ]
- “Terminal Expanse”: Science Officer 0718, now serving aboard the U.S.S. Yorktown, mentions that he was part of the team aboard the Enterprise that developed the technology to neutralize the Sphere Builder technology.
Notes[ | ]
- The design of the Kelvin Enterprise in “The Measure of Morality (Part 2)” was based off its appearance in Star Trek (2009), not the modified version from Star Trek Beyond (in game as the Kelvin Constitution Legendary Intel Battlecruiser).
